What is the cheapest area to stay in Key West?
When you want a cheap place to stay in Key West, consider Key West Historic District and Old Town Key West which often have budget-friendly hotels. Are you looking to stay in another area of the city? Pinpoint low-cost hotels in the another part of town using our map feature.

Can I stay in a hostel in Key West?
Hostels can be a less expensive alternative to Key West hotels, as you can stay in a shared dormitory. There is 1 hostel in Key West. Seashell Motel & Key West Hostel offers free in-room WiFi and free parking.
What are the best cheap things to do in Key West?
Sightseeing doesn’t have to be expensive. For some things to do in Key West, stroll along Duval Street or you can get outdoors at Florida Keys National Marine Sanctuary. Be certain a visit to Key West Lighthouse and Keeper’s Quarters Museum is in your plans.
